Cleocin Description
Overview of Cleocin
Cleocin, also known by its generic name clindamycin, is an antibiotic commonly used to treat a variety of infections caused by bacteria. It is available in several forms, including capsules, topical solutions, and injections. In the UK, Cleocin is prescribed by healthcare professionals for treating skin infections, respiratory tract infections, and certain types of bacterial infections that do not respond to other antibiotics. Its effectiveness relies on its ability to inhibit bacterial protein synthesis, making it a potent option against specific bacteria.
Usage and Dosage
When prescribed in the UK, Cleocin is usually taken orally, typically with a glass of water. The dosage depends on the severity of the infection, patient age, and medical history. It is important to follow the doctor's instructions carefully and complete the course even if symptoms improve early. In some cases, the medication may be administered via injection, particularly in hospital settings. Topical forms are also used to treat skin conditions like acne and bacterial skin infections, applied directly to the affected area. Always adhere to the prescribed regimen to ensure effective treatment and reduce the risk of resistance.

Possible Side Effects
Like all medications, Cleocin may cause side effects in some users. Common issues include gastrointestinal disturbances such as nausea, diarrhoea, or abdominal pain. Some individuals might experience allergic reactions, ranging from skin rash to more severe symptoms like difficulty breathing. In rare cases, prolonged use can lead to overgrowth of non-susceptible bacteria or fungi. It is essential to inform your healthcare provider if you experience any unusual or severe side effects. Regular monitoring during treatment can help manage and minimise adverse reactions.
Considerations and Precautions
Patients in the UK should disclose their full medical history to their healthcare provider before starting Cleocin. This includes any liver problems, colitis, or allergies. It is particularly important to exercise caution in pregnant or breastfeeding women, as the safety profile of clindamycin in these groups varies. Avoid alcohol consumption during treatment, as it may increase side effects. Additionally, taking probiotics or eating yoghurt can help maintain healthy gut bacteria, reducing gastrointestinal issues. Always use Cleocin exactly as prescribed to avoid contributing to antibiotic resistance or ineffective treatment.
